Introduction

Introduction DO'S

1st Sentence: State your subject

2nd Sentence: Tell how you feel about the subject

3rd Sentence: State your 3 reasons

Page 11: Presented by Beverly Dunaway. What is Expository Writing?   for-kids/writing/expository-writing-song

Introduction Example

The one job around the house that I hate to do more than anything else is the garbage. Sometimes I wish that the garbage would just learn to take itself out. Taking the garbage out is such a horrible task because it stinks, it is sticky, and the dogs always carry it away.

Conclusion

Conclusion DO's 1st Sentence: Restate your subject

2nd Sentence: Restate your reasons

3rd Sentence: State a sentence about the future of the subject

Page 14: Presented by Beverly Dunaway. What is Expository Writing?   for-kids/writing/expository-writing-song

Conclusion Example

Taking out the garbage is the worst household job in the world. No one should have to suffer through the smell, stickiness, or aggravation of the dogs. One day, I hope to be able to have a machine to carry it away for me.
